ইয়ে: এওআর এর জন্য দুর্দান্ত সহায়ক এবং ইয়াওর্টের বিকল্প

Yaourt

আর্চ লিনাক্স ব্যবহারকারী এবং ডেরিভেটিভস আপনি জানবেন যে ইয়াওর্টের ব্যবহারের আর সুপারিশ করা হয়নি, কারণ এই AUR সহকারী আর সমর্থন পায় না এবং বন্ধ আছে, তাই এটি অন্য কিছু সহকারী ব্যবহার করার পরামর্শ দেওয়া হয়।

সে কারণেই দিনটি আজ আমরা আপনার সাথে একটি দুর্দান্ত এওআর সহায়ক আপনার সাথে ভাগ করতে যাচ্ছি, যা আমরা ইওর্ট এবং এমনকি প্যাকাউরের জন্য একটি দুর্দান্ত প্রতিস্থাপন হিসাবে বিবেচনা করতে পারি যা বন্ধ রয়েছে।

আমরা যে সহকারীটির কথা বলব তা হ্যাঁ হ্যাঁ (তবুও অন্য ইয়াওর্ট), এটি নির্ভরযোগ্য AUR এর জন্য নতুন সহায়ক যা জিও প্রোগ্রামিং ভাষায় লেখা হয়েছে।

ইয়ে সম্পর্কে

হ্যাঁ আমরা প্যাকম্যানের জন্য একটি ইন্টারফেস সরবরাহ করে এবং এটি একটি উইজার্ড যা প্রায় কোনও নির্ভরতা প্রয়োজন। এটি ইওর্ট, এপ্যাকম্যান এবং প্যাকর ডিজাইনের ভিত্তিতে তৈরি।

আরেকটি বৈশিষ্ট্য যা আমরা এই সহায়কটির হাইলাইট করতে পারি তা হ'ল স্ব-পরিপূর্ণ ফাংশন রয়েছে, তাই কেবল কয়েকটি প্রাথমিক চিঠি লিখুন এবং এই উইজার্ডটি আপনাকে নামটি সম্পূর্ণ করতে সহায়তা করবে।

entre এর প্রধান বৈশিষ্ট্যগুলি হাইলাইট করা যেতে পারে:

  • হ্যাঁ ABS বা AUR থেকে PKGBUILD ডাউনলোড করুন।
  • সংকীর্ণ অনুসন্ধান সমর্থন করে এবং পিকেজিইউআইএলডি এর উত্স পায় না।
  • বাইনারিটির প্যাকম্যান ছাড়া কোনও অতিরিক্ত নির্ভরতা নেই।
  • একটি উন্নত নির্ভরতা সমাধানকারী সরবরাহ করে এবং বিল্ড প্রক্রিয়া শেষে মেকিং নির্ভরতাগুলি সরিয়ে দেয়।
  • আপনি /etc/pacman.conf ফাইলে রঙ বিকল্পটি সক্ষম করলে এটি রঙিন আউটপুট সমর্থন করে।

কিভাবে আর্চ লিনাক্স এবং ডেরিভেটিভসে ইয়ে ইনস্টল করবেন?

Si আপনি আপনার সিস্টেমে এই উইজার্ডটি এআর এর জন্য ইনস্টল করতে চান want, আমরা নীচে ভাগ করা নিম্নলিখিত সূচকগুলি অনুসরণ করতে পারেন।

এই প্রক্রিয়াটি আর্চ লিনাক্স থেকে প্রাপ্ত যে কোনও বিতরণের জন্যও বৈধ।

আপনার যদি ইয়াওর্ট বা অন্য কোনও সহকারী রয়েছে তবে আপনি এটির সাহায্যে এটি ইনস্টল করতে পারেন, ইয়াওর্টের উদাহরণে কেবল টাইপ করুন:

yaourt -S yay

যদি তা না হয় তবে আমরা প্যাকেজটি তৈরি করতে পারি, প্রথমে আমাদের অবশ্যই একটি টার্মিনাল খুলতে হবে এবং এতে আমরা নিম্নলিখিত কমান্ডটি টাইপ করব:

sudo pacman -S git
git clone https://aur.archlinux.org/yay.git
cd yay
makepkg -si

এবং আপনি এটি দিয়ে শেষ করেছেন, উইজার্ডটি ইনস্টল করা আছে, এখন আপনাকে কেবল এটি ব্যবহার শুরু করতে হবে।

ইয়ে এর বেসিক ব্যবহার

হ্যাঁ

এই উইজার্ডটি অন্যের মতো, তারা প্যাকম্যানের মতো একটি অনুরূপ সিনট্যাক্স ব্যবহার করে, তাই এর ব্যবহার আসলেই মোটেই কঠিন নয়।

ব্যবহারের প্রাথমিক আদেশগুলি হ'ল, AUR তে একটি প্যাকেজ বা অ্যাপ্লিকেশন ইনস্টল করতে:

yay -S <package-name>

En ক্ষেত্রে আপনি একই সাথে অফিসিয়াল সংগ্রহস্থলগুলির মধ্যে এবং এওআর-তে একটি অ্যাপ্লিকেশন অনুসন্ধান করতে চান, আমরা পতাকা "গুলি" যোগ করি

yay -Ss <package-name>

উদাহরণস্বরূপ, অন্য কেস, আপনার যদি কেবলমাত্র একটি নির্দিষ্ট প্যাকেজের তথ্য জানতে হয়:

yay -Si <package-name>

আমরা যদি চাই একটি স্থানীয় প্যাকেজ ইনস্টল করুন, কেবল টাইপ করুন:

yay -U ruta-del-paquete

কেবলমাত্র প্যাকেজের নাম রাখাও এটি সম্ভব এবং এটি মানদণ্ডের সাথে সম্পর্কিত সকলের জন্য অনুসন্ধান করবে এবং এটি আমাদের খুঁজে পাওয়া তালিকাতে প্রদর্শিত করবে এবং আমাদের আগ্রহের মধ্যে একটি নির্বাচন করতে বলবে।

yay <package-name>

আমাদের কাছে কী আপডেট রয়েছে তা আপনি জানতে চাইলে কেবল টাইপ করুন:

yay -Pu

যদি আপনি কেবল প্রয়োজন ডাটাবেস থেকে প্যাকেজ সিঙ্ক করুন:

yay -Sy

তারা চাইলে একটি সিস্টেম আপডেট সম্পাদন করুন যা আমাদের টাইপ করতে হবে:

yay -Syu

ইনস্টল করা AUR প্যাকেজ সহ সিস্টেম আপডেট করুন, আমরা কেবল টাইপ করি:

yay -Syua

পাড়া কমিটস ছাড়াই যে কোনও প্যাকেজ ইনস্টল করুন (ব্যবহারকারীর হস্তক্ষেপ ছাড়াই অবশ্যই), "-নোকনফার্ম" বিকল্পটি ব্যবহার করুন।

yay -S --noconfirm <package-name>

অযাচিত নির্ভরতা নির্মূল করতে, কেবল নিম্নলিখিতটি টাইপ করুন:

yay -Yc

আমরা যদি অ্যাপ্লিকেশন ক্যাশে পরিষ্কার করতে চাই তবে কেবল টাইপ করুন:

yay -Scc

আপনি যদি একটি প্যাকেজ বা অ্যাপ্লিকেশন "কেবল" মুছতে চান তবে:

yay -R <package-name>

কোনও প্যাকেজ বা অ্যাপ্লিকেশন এর নির্ভরতা সহ অপসারণ করতে:

yay -Rs <package-name>

প্যাকেজ, তার নির্ভরতা এবং কনফিগারেশনগুলি সরাতে আমাদের অবশ্যই টাইপ করতে হবে:

yay -Rnsc

ইয়ে ব্যবহার সম্পর্কে আপনি যদি আরও কিছু জানতে চান তবে টাইপ করে এর ম্যানুয়ালটির সাথে পরামর্শ করতে পারেন:

man yay